在PHP中,PDO是連接MySQL數(shù)據(jù)庫的一種常用方式。本文將介紹連接MySQL數(shù)據(jù)庫的步驟,幫助讀者了解如何使用PDO連接MySQL數(shù)據(jù)庫。
步驟1:準(zhǔn)備MySQL數(shù)據(jù)庫
在使用PDO連接MySQL之前,需要先準(zhǔn)備好MySQL數(shù)據(jù)庫。如果您還沒有安裝MySQL數(shù)據(jù)庫,請先下載并安裝MySQL數(shù)據(jù)庫。
步驟2:創(chuàng)建數(shù)據(jù)庫連接
在PHP中,使用PDO連接MySQL數(shù)據(jù)庫的第一步是創(chuàng)建一個PDO對象。通過PDO對象,可以連接到MySQL數(shù)據(jù)庫并執(zhí)行SQL語句。
以下是創(chuàng)建PDO對象的代碼示例:
```php
$dbhost = 'localhost'; // MySQL主機(jī)名ame = 'testdb'; // 數(shù)據(jù)庫名
$dbuser = 'testuser'; // 用戶名
$dbpass = 'testpass'; // 密碼
try {ewysqlameame", $dbuser, $dbpass);
echo "數(shù)據(jù)庫連接成功!"; $e) {
echo "數(shù)據(jù)庫連接失敗:" . $e->getMessage();
在上述代碼中,我們使用PDO的構(gòu)造函數(shù)創(chuàng)建了一個PDO對象,并傳遞了MySQL主機(jī)名、數(shù)據(jù)庫名、用戶名和密碼作為參數(shù)。如果連接成功,則輸出“數(shù)據(jù)庫連接成功!”;否則,輸出連接失敗的錯誤消息。
步驟3:執(zhí)行SQL語句
創(chuàng)建PDO對象后,就可以使用它來執(zhí)行SQL語句了。以下是執(zhí)行SQL語句的代碼示例:
```php
$sql = "SELECT * FROM users";t = $pdo->query($sql);
t->fetch()) {ame'] . '
';
t變量中。然后,通過循環(huán)遍歷結(jié)果集,并輸出每一行的用戶名。
步驟4:關(guān)閉數(shù)據(jù)庫連接
在使用完P(guān)DO對象后,應(yīng)該關(guān)閉與MySQL數(shù)據(jù)庫的連接,以釋放資源。以下是關(guān)閉數(shù)據(jù)庫連接的代碼示例:
```php
ull屬性來關(guān)閉與MySQL數(shù)據(jù)庫的連接。
本文介紹了使用PDO連接MySQL數(shù)據(jù)庫的步驟,包括準(zhǔn)備MySQL數(shù)據(jù)庫、創(chuàng)建數(shù)據(jù)庫連接、執(zhí)行SQL語句和關(guān)閉數(shù)據(jù)庫連接。通過本文的介紹,讀者可以了解如何使用PDO連接MySQL數(shù)據(jù)庫,并在自己的PHP項目中使用。